Studenice - Sveta Lucija above Studenice
Starting point: Studenice (260 m)
Starting point Lat/Lon: 46.2999°N 15.6138°E 
Time of walking: 20 min
Difficulty: easy unmarked way
Difficulty of skiing: no data
Altitude difference: 30 m
Altitude difference (by path): 38 m
Map: Posavsko hribovje Boč - Bohor 1:50.000
Access to starting point:
A) From the direction of Ljubljana we leave the highway in Slovenske Konjice and through Žiče, Loče and Zbelovo we get to the center of Poljčane. In the center, we turn right in the direction of Studenice and after about three kilometers we reach Studenice, where we continue right across the bridge over the river Dravinja into the main part of the settlement. In front of the monastery complex we safely park.
B) From the direction of Maribor we leave the highway in Slovenska Bistrica, where signs point us to Poljčane. In the center, we turn left in the direction of Studenice and after about three kilometers we reach Studenice, where we continue right across the bridge over the river Dravinja into the main part of the settlement. In front of the monastery complex we safely park.
C) From the direction of Ptuj, Kidričevo through Ptujska gora, Majšperk and Makol we get to Studenice, where we continue left across the bridge over the river Dravinja into the main part of the settlement. In front of the monastery complex we safely park.
Path description:
After a short introductory tour of the main part of Studenice, we continue north through the settlement Studenice on the road along the stream. We continue across the bridge over Dravinja and immediately somewhat left and straight between the house of culture and transformer. We continue left in a gentle ascent on a meadow path between the house on the left and kindergarten on the right side. At the kindergarten, we turn right and on an asphalt surface we continue somewhat steeper upwards towards the destination, which is visible. We follow the road and soon reach the parking area in front of the church of St. Lucija, which is inside the walls surrounded by the cemetery.
